The filter setting must be set to YES so that the machine recognizes that the filter is in<br />
use. The factory setting is without a filter.<br />
☛ If you use a filter in your coffee machine and have programmed the system filter<br />
setting to YES, programming for water hardness and decalcifying will not be<br />
shown anymore.<br />
• Press the programming button P in order to start program mode.<br />
• Press the > button until the display shows FILTER.<br />
• Press the ok button.<br />
• Press the > button until the display shows YES.<br />
• Confirm with the ok button.<br />
• The display will now show insert FILTER / TURN valve alternatingly.<br />
• Empty the water tank (17) screw the filter into the holder (21) using the mounting<br />
tool (22).<br />
• Fill the tank with freshwater and replace it in the machine.<br />
• Hold a receptacle under the hot water jet (12) and turn the dial (11) to the right. The<br />
system will now be rinsed.<br />
• Wait until no more water comes out of the jet and then turn the dial (11) closed to<br />
the left.<br />
• The system will heat up briefly and is then ready for operation again.<br />
(It can happen that the service button [2] is still blinking. Press the button [2] and a<br />
short rinse will take place through the coffee outlet [8].)<br />
☛ The effectiveness of the filter is exhausted after about 50 l of water. The display<br />
will indicate that the filter must be changed (see chapter 5.2).<br />
Important: Even if the display shows nothing, the filter should be changed after<br />
two months at the latest even if little coffee was brewed.<br />
Without filter<br />
If you do not want to use a filter anymore, the filter setting must be reprogrammed to NO.<br />
This is important since without a filter it is necessary to decalcify the coffee machine.<br />
• Press the programming button P in order to start program mode.<br />
• Press the > button until the display shows FILTER.<br />
• Press the ok button.<br />
• Press the > button until the display shows NO.<br />
• Confirm with the ok button. The display will now show FILTER.<br />
• From this point you can go directly to programming other settings or use the exit<br />
button to leave program mode.<br />
☛ Don't forget to program the water hardness (see section 4.3).<br />
4.3 Water hardness<br />
Depending on the hardness of the water in your region and whether you are using a<br />
filter (see chapter 4.2), your coffee machine must be decalcified sooner or later. So that<br />
the system can show when decalcification is necessary, you must first enter the correct<br />
water hardness setting before using the coffee machine for the first time.<br />
